Sec. 17. A director who has either a direct or indirect interest in a matter before the corporation shall disclose that interest before the corporation takes action on the matter. This disclosure shall be made a part of the record of the corporation's official proceedings and the interested director shall refrain from participation in the corporation relating to the matter.
